The Purchase block lets you sell a product or subscription directly on a landing page. It uses your connected Stripe account for checkout, so payments, receipts and (for subscriptions) recurring billing are handled by Stripe. For details on connecting Stripe and how purchases create people and actions, see Connecting Stripe to CamBuildr.
Adding a Purchase block
Drag the Purchase block onto your page and click Edit. The editor is organised into steps – Product, Signup and Thank you. A connected Stripe account is required; if Stripe isn't your payment provider or you have no products yet, the editor will tell you.
Step 1: Product
Select a product from your Stripe catalogue. Products are managed in your Stripe dashboard.
If the product has more than one price, choose which one to sell (a single price is selected automatically).
Set the purchase button text.
Whether a purchase is one-time or a recurring subscription comes from the Stripe price you select – there's nothing extra to configure here.
Step 2: Signup
Set the description and button text for the data-collection step.
Toggle Ask for address if you need the buyer's address.
Enable a disclaimer with your own text, and add Multi-Consent options if that feature is enabled for your account.
Step 3: Thank you
Set the headline and description shown after a successful purchase. Placeholders are supported so you can personalise the message.
Styling
Match the block to your page using primary and secondary colours, background colour or transparency, rounded edges, and custom CSS.
